## Break-Glass Access: Faregate Pricing Experiment

This page covers emergency access for external plugin authors integrating with the Faregate ticket-pricing experiment. If the experiment service rejects your plugin's calls during a rollout and normal credentials fail, break-glass access restores read-only visibility into the pricing variants so you can debug without blocking the test. Use it sparingly; each use is logged and reviewed. The break-glass console will prompt for the recovery passphrase printed immediately below.

vault phrase of bagaf-kajeg = jorath-feniel-briir-siliel-ralix

**Step 4: Shard the profile store**

Alright, future maintainer — this is where Pebblemart's user-profile store gets split across the four Quillbase shards. Run `quill-shard plan --ring profiles` and sanity-check that no shard lands above 30% of keys. If the plan looks lopsided, bump the virtual node count and re-run. Once you apply it, the rebalancer needs to authenticate against the shard coordinator, so it reads credentials from `.env.shard` in the deploy root. Append this single line:

secret setting of tawif-tajop: COURIER_KEY13=819c65d82d2bd

Subject: Cold storage archival cutover for Driftvault buckets

Hi Marrowline integration team,

Starting next sprint we're migrating all cold storage buckets in Driftvault to the new archival tier. Please ensure your nightly sync jobs point at the `archive-v3` endpoint before the cutover, and verify checksums on the first full run. For authenticated access during the migration window, use the bearer token provided below.

session JWT of yawep-yawep = eyJhbGciOiJIUzI1NiIsInR5cCI6IkpXVCJ9.eyJzdWIiOiI3pWF3_In0.aXYsHiog